Handover Note — Loyalty Programme Overhaul

To my successor: the Corrandale Rewards overhaul is mid-flight. Tier structure is approved; the points-migration tooling from the Westhollow team lands next sprint. Finance should note the accrual model changes — liability recognition shifts to redemption-based from next quarter, and Merrit in accounting has the reconciliation workbook. Budget remains within envelope, though the comms spend needs sign-off. Outstanding risks are tracked in the programme register. The strategic context sits below.

internal memo for kawip-hadug: Headcount on the Wenwyn team goes from 7 to 140 by the end of January. Gross margin on Wenwyn came in at 20 percent against a plan of 15 percent.

Subject: Scheduled key rotation — SQLint pipeline

Hi, and welcome aboard. As part of our quarterly security routine, we rotated the credential used by the SQLint service, which enforces our linting rules on all SQL files before merge. Any local tooling you configured during onboarding last week will start failing with authentication errors until you update it. The old key is fully revoked as of this morning, so please don't waste time debugging lint failures first. Update your local config to use the new key below.

gateway credential: zpat15_lMLOSdhT94y0U3l

Subject: Key rotation for InvoiceForge renderer

Welcome, new folks. Every quarter we rotate the credential the Pellworth PDF invoice renderer uses to call our internal asset service, Vaultline. The old key stops working Friday at noon. Update your local .env and the staging config before then, and verify a test invoice renders with the new embedded fonts. For convenience, the freshly issued key is included here.

app token of bagef-bageg = kto11_vuwA0uhrEMg